“Red Beard Bandit” Wanted By Police

Suspect allegedly robbed several gas stations all over San Diego

The San Diego Police Department is continuing their investigation on a series of gas station robberies that occurred earlier this month in Kearny Mesa, Grantville and University City.

The robberies began on Mar. 10, when a male suspect – dubbed the “Red Beard Bandit” by San Diego Police -- committed an armed robbery at the AM/PM at 3700 Murphy Canyon Rd. The suspect pulled a black handgun from his jacket pocket and demanded money from the clerk. Once he got the cash, the suspect fled the scene.

The robberies continued with two more cases the following evening, on Mar. 11. The Arco gas station at 6400 Mission Gorge Rd. was robbed at around 7:15 p.m., followed by a robbery at the AM/PM located at 8800 Clairemont Mesa Blvd. around 10 p.m. On Mar. 12, the same suspect allegedly robbed the United Oil gas station at 3800 Governor Dr. just before 10:30 p.m., again with a handgun, according to police.

Then, on Mar. 13, he robbed the Shell gas station at 7700 Clairemont Mesa Blvd. The suspect fled toward the parking lot but the clerk chased him down, resulting in a struggle, police said. The suspect left his handgun and stolen money in the parking lot and was seen getting into the passenger side of a maroon Chrysler Sebring.

The San Diego Police Department said the alleged suspect in connection with these robberies is described as a white male in his 40s to 50s. He’s 6-feet-tall with a medium to heavy build and wore a dark hooded jacket with the word “Viejas” on the front, a dark or red baseball cap and jeans during the armed robberies.

Police said he’s described as having red hair and a red beard in two cases, so they’ve appropriately dubbed him the “Red Beard Bandit.”
